Emergency crews were called to the 100 block of Everwoods Court SW around 8:20 a.m.
Police say officers found a man and woman injured in a parked car, suffering from gunshot wounds.
An EMS spokesman says one of the victims, a woman in her 30s, was pronounced dead at the scene.
Paramedics took the second victim, a man in his 30s, to hospital in critical, life-threatening condition.
A dark brown Bentley was seen parked in the driveway of the house, which is near the corner of a cul-de-sac.
Calgary police investigate a shooting in the 100 block of Everwoods Court SW on Thursday, August 18, 2022.
Neighbor Edgar Gallardo says the vehicle had caught his eye before.
“It’s always been a very quiet neighborhood, but to hear that a woman was shot and killed there and to see the police cars is very strange,” Gallardo said.
Another neighbor, Natalia Gomez, says she woke up to the sound of police sirens and several emergency vehicles outside her door.
Calgary police are investigating a shooting in the 100 block of Everwoods Court SW on Thursday, August 18, 2022. “It’s shocking. “I’ve always felt safe in my neighborhood, but now I feel like, ‘Oh, there’s stuff going on behind the scenes that I don’t clearly know about,’” she said.
Natalia’s father, Diego, adds that he never expected something like this to happen so close to the home they had lived in for nearly 20 years.
“It’s very sad because these communities are very quiet,” he said.
“Nobody wants to see any kind of violence in this neighborhood, and all my neighbors here are probably concerned.”
The incident marks the 92nd shooting in Calgary so far this year, approaching last year’s total of 96.
